Who is eligible for the Educational Consultancy Service?
The Educational Consultancy Service may be offered to individuals wishing to prepare for the demanding OMG Certified Systems Modelling Professional (OCSMP) exams. Webel IT Australia is an OMG Accredited Training Provider for SysML, certified to offer training for preparation up to the Model Builder Intermediate (MBI) level exam.
The Educational Consultancy Service may be offered to individuals who already have some experience with SysML for MBSE and are seeking assistance with advanced topics such as:
- Activity and StateMachine simulation in Magic Model Analyst® (Cameo Simulation Toolkit®)
- The Webel Parsing Analysis recipe for SysML
- Domain Special Language (DSL) model element creation and advanced use of custom Profiles.
- Creating custom model validation rule suites.
- How to use SysML for capturing formal Systems Engineering (SE) methodologies.
- Specific tool features such as model query report customisation.
- Advanced use of Object Constraint Language (OCL) with SysML or UML.
The Educational Consultancy Service may also be offered to individuals seeking assistance with UML-driven software engineering, OO Design Patterns and software architecture, and reverse-engineering using the MagicDraw® UML (aka Magic Software Architect) tool.
